Mashreq (Sharaf DG) Metro Station Red Line is one of the most well-known stops on the Dubai Metro network, connecting the vibrant communities of Al Barsha and Al Sufouh to the rest of the city. Opened in October 2010, this station was originally named “Sharaf DG” after the famous electronics retail chain but was later renamed to “Mashreq” in 2020. Despite the renaming, many residents and visitors still fondly call it by its original name, making it one of the few metro stations in Dubai that is popularly known by two names.

Station Overview
Here’s the Quick Facts table for Mashreq Metro Station Red Line:
Quick Facts | Details |
---|---|
Station Code | R33 |
Metro Line | Red Line |
Opened On | October 15, 2010 |
Previous Name | Sharaf DG |
Park-and-Ride Facility | Yes |
Fare Zone | 2 |
Location | Al Barsha, Al Sufouh |
The station sits in a busy commercial and residential hub, offering convenient access to many popular landmarks. With modern facilities, escalators, lifts, and air-conditioned concourses, Mashreq Metro Station offers the comfort and efficiency Dubai Metro is known for.
Mashreq (Sharaf DG) Metro Station Timings
The Dubai Metro operates every day of the week, and Mashreq Metro Station follows the same schedule. Since the UAE shifted its weekends in 2022, timings are as follows:
-
Saturday to Thursday: 6:00 AM – 11:00 PM (next day)
-
Friday: 2:00 PM – midnight (next day)
On public holidays such as Eid, UAE National Day, or New Year, the Roads and Transport Authority (RTA) sometimes extends metro timings to accommodate higher passenger volumes. For the latest updates, passengers are encouraged to check with the RTA by calling 800 90 90.

Park-and-Ride Facilities
A major advantage of Mashreq Metro Station is its park-and-ride car park, allowing commuters to park their vehicles and continue their journey via the metro. This is particularly useful for those coming from surrounding neighborhoods who wish to avoid peak-hour traffic on Sheikh Zayed Road.
The facility is safe, well-lit, and monitored by CCTV, making it convenient for both short and long-term use.
Bus Connectivity at Mashreq Metro Station
Dubai’s RTA ensures seamless integration between the metro and bus network. Outside Mashreq Metro Station, there are multiple bus stops that connect passengers to different parts of the city.
Bus Timings:
-
Sunday to Saturday: 04:00 AM – 01:00 AM (next day)
-
Route C01: Operates 24 hours
Bus Routes from Mashreq Metro Station:
-
81 – Connects to Dubai Internet City and other business districts
-
F33 – Links Al Barsha 3 and Al Barsha South
-
F35 – Covers areas like The Greens and Barsha Heights
The buses are punctual, affordable, and air-conditioned, providing excellent last-mile connectivity.
